Connecting the Dots: Securing the Overlooked Corners of the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C) Supply Chain
Unit 42 warns attackers increasingly target CI/CD pipelines and developer tools rather than application code, urging full SDLC supply chain visibility.
Palo Alto Networks Unit 42 research argues attackers are shifting focus from application code to overlooked corners of the software development lifecycle supply chain, including CI/CD pipelines and developer tooling. The write-up calls for total SDLC visibility and strict security controls to defend these developer-facing attack surfaces.
